1406. SMEs' immunity
1 minute de lecture
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s) may be immune from financial penalties for agreements that may infringe the Chapter I prohibition and conduct that may infringe the Chapter II prohibition. This immunity does not, however, apply to price fixing agreements. Statutory Instrument 2000 No 262 indicates the criteria used to determine if agreements or conduct is of minor significance.
